elasticsearch
文章平均质量分 63
Dream_Mir_Hui_Gir
Stay Hungry, Stay Foolish.
给我一双翅膀,让我冲出这黑光
展开
-
elasticsearch笔记之java客户端操作
文章目录一、前言二、使用步骤1.导入依赖2.读入数据总结 一、前言 今天来讲解一下,如何使用java程序操作elasticsearch,实现数据的增删改查,在以往,我们都是通过开启kibana服务来实现es数据的增删改查,但是在真实的开发场景中,这些操作都是需要移植到程序中的,于是就有了今天这篇文章,学习如何使用java程序实现elasticsearch数据的增删改查。 二、使用步骤 1.导入依赖 以SpringBoot为基础,创建一个SpringBoot项目, <!--java版es客户端-->原创 2021-02-27 22:56:22 · 318 阅读 · 1 评论 -
elasticsearch笔记之文档基本操作
文章目录一、elasticsearch文档操作是什么?二、使用步骤1.添加数据2.获取数据3.更新数据4.查询语句标题简单查询语句标准查询语句两种分词的方式总结 一、elasticsearch文档操作是什么? 我们都知道,在数据库里面,有很多的查询语句,插入数据,更新数据,删除数据等等,那么同理,在elasticsearch当中,也有类似的操作,只不过语法跟数据库不同罢了,那么究竟怎么使用呢?下面我们来看下。 二、使用步骤 1.添加数据 #往索引lhh里面加入一条信息 put /lhh/user/1 {原创 2021-02-26 23:32:12 · 705 阅读 · 0 评论 -
elasticsearch笔记之rest风格的操作
文章目录一、elasticsearch增删改查二、使用步骤1.基本操作总结 一、elasticsearch增删改查 跟数据库一样,把它当做一个数据库,有增删改查的功能,开启了elasticsearch服务之后(localhost:9200),然后通过开启elasticsearch-head-master(localhost:9100)就可以查看里面有什么数据了,最主要的是通过kibana操作elasticsearch的数据(locaihost:5601)。 二、使用步骤 1.基本操作 #kibana原创 2021-02-26 19:44:19 · 281 阅读 · 0 评论 -
elasticsearch笔记之ik分词器详解
文章目录一、ik分词器是什么?二、使用步骤1.开启服务验证2.ik分词器演示总结 一、ik分词器是什么? 我们都知道,在平时使用搜索引擎搜索东西的时候,我们自己输入的关键字,有可能会被分隔成好几个字或者词,最常见的比如我们使用百度搜索关键字的话,那么所有与该关键字相关的都会显示出来,并把出现关键字的文档标红,而且单条记录可能出现多个标红,如图所示 或者像这样的。,但凡与你的 或者像这样的,但凡文档当中出现了一个或者多个与搜索的关键相匹配的文本,都会被标红。 于是乎,今天我们的主角闪耀登场了,他就是ela原创 2021-02-25 18:31:06 · 2076 阅读 · 0 评论 -
docker笔记之容器镜像命令
文章目录一、镜像命令二、容器命令三、总结 一、镜像命令 #查看所有的镜像 [root@iZbp10d5h2h0qbsabf055iZ docker]# docker images REPOSITORY TAG IMAGE ID CREATED SIZE hello-world latest bf756fb1ae65 13 months ago 13.3kB [root@iZbp10d5h2h0qbsabf055iZ docker]# docke原创 2021-02-10 10:37:10 · 278 阅读 · 0 评论 -
docker笔记之安装tomcat、nginx、easticsearch
文章目录二、安装步骤1.tomcat2.nginx3、elasticsearch总结 二、安装步骤 1.tomcat [root@iZbp10d5h2h0qbsabf055iZ /]# docker pull tomcat Using default tag: latest latest: Pulling from library/tomcat b9a857cbf04d: Pull complete d557ee20540b: Pull complete 3b9ca4f00c2e: Pull compl原创 2021-02-10 10:35:34 · 170 阅读 · 0 评论 -
elasticsearch跨域问题
在es的文件夹中的bin目录下启动elasticsearch.bat目录之后,发现可以成功访问localhost:9200 在es-head文件夹下启动cmd命令界面,通过npm run start启动es的图形化界面,效果如下 但是当启动一个elasticsearch-head的时候,想要连接es,发现连接不上,也就是所谓的跨域问题,报错如下: 那么我们关闭es服务,然后找到配置文件,在配置文件中elasticsearch.yml配置文件中添加以下两行表示启动es跨域 #需要注意的是,yml的语法格原创 2020-12-27 21:47:31 · 1311 阅读 · 0 评论